1.1 root 1: /* date.h - net2xt, xt2net, isleap, ut2ltim */
2:
3: /* Xinu stores time as seconds past Jan 1, 1970 (UNIX format), with */
4: /* 1 being 1 second into Jan. 1, 1970, GMT (universal time). The */
5: /* Internet uses seconds past Jan 1, 1900 (also GMT or universal time) */
6:
7: #define net2xt(x) ((x)-2208988800L) /* convert net-to-xinu time */
8: #define xt2net(x) ((x)+2208988800L) /* convert xinu-to-net time */
9:
10: /* Days in months and month names used to format a date */
11:
12: struct datinfo {
13: int dt_msize[12];
14: char *dt_mnam[12];
15: };
16:
17: extern struct datinfo Dat;
18:
19: /* Constants for converting time to month/day/year/hour/minute/second */
20:
21: #define isleap(x) ((x)%4==0) /* leap year? (1970-1999) */
22: #define SECPERDY (60L*60L*24L) /* one day in seconds */
23: #define SECPERHR (60L*60L) /* one hour in seconds */
24: #define SECPERMN (60L) /* one minute in seconds */
25:
26: /* date doesn't understand daylight savings time (it was built in */
27: /* Indiana where we're smart enough to realize that renumbering */
28: /* doesn't save anything). However, the local time zone can be */
29: /* set to EST, CST, MST,or PST. */
30:
31: #define ZONE_EST 5 /* Eastern Standard time is 5 */
32: #define ZONE_CST 6 /* hours west of England */
33: #define ZONE_MST 7
34: #define ZONE_PST 8
35: #define TIMEZONE ZONE_EST /* timezone for this system */
36:
37: /* In-line procedure that converts universal time to local time */
38:
39: #define ut2ltim(x) ((x)-TIMEZONE*SECPERHR)
40: #ifndef TSERVER
41: #define TSERVER "128.10.2.3:37"
42: #endif
